Japanese Authenticity Rating

6/10 Rich with a moderate Japanese atmosphere, this ryokan offers rooms with traditional tatamis and futons. The architecture is simple, while the meals, although local, lack Kaiseki refinement. The available baths remain basic, without the charm of a natural spring. A pleasant experience but with a mix of authenticity and simplicity.

Customer Reviews: What They Liked


Guests appreciated the ryokan’s central location, near the bus station, onsens, town, and ski slopes, as well as the ease of access to transportation and ski equipment.

The homemade Japanese breakfast is often described as excellent, healthy, and varied, providing a good start to the day.

The traditional Japanese rooms with tatami and futons are considered comfortable and spacious, even for groups or with large suitcases, despite some reviews on the comfort of futons for tall people.

The cleanliness of the premises and the pleasantness of the communal spaces are also highlighted, with amenities like Wi-Fi, free tea and coffee, and drying facilities for snow equipment.

The owners are often mentioned for their warm welcome and friendliness, contributing to a positive experience for guests.


Frequently Asked Questions

Is there an onsen available at Minshuku Kojima?

No, Minshuku Kojima does not have its own onsen, but it is located in the spa town of Nozawa Onsen, known for its many nearby hot springs.

What are the check-in and check-out times?

Check-ins are between 3:00 PM and 10:00 PM, while check-outs should take place between 6:00 AM and 10:00 AM. Note that there is a curfew from 11:00 PM to 6:00 AM.

What languages are spoken at Minshuku Kojima?

The staff primarily speaks Japanese. It is advisable to have some basic knowledge of Japanese or a translation tool on hand.

Are there any specific restrictions or rules to follow?

Yes, Minshuku Kojima is a non-smoking establishment and pets are not allowed. Additionally, a curfew is in place from 11:00 PM to 6:00 AM.

What wellness services are offered?

Although Minshuku Kojima does not directly offer wellness services, its location in Nozawa Onsen allows you to enjoy numerous hot springs and public baths in the area.

What dining options are available?

Minshuku Kojima offers breakfast to start the day off right. For lunch and dinner, several restaurants are accessible nearby.

Does Minshuku Kojima have parking?

Yes, public parking is available nearby by reservation, at a rate of ¥1,800 per day.

What are the main tourist sites nearby?

You will be close to the Ryuoo ski resort, the Jigokudani Monkey Park, and the Hokuryuko and Nojiri lakes. Many natural and cultural sites are easily accessible.

Are pets allowed?

No, unfortunately, pets are not allowed at Minshuku Kojima.

What cultural activities can be done nearby?

Enjoy Japanese culture by visiting the Takahashi Mayumi Doll Museum and exploring local markets and festivals, often organized in Nozawa Onsen.

What transportation options are available?

Iiyama Station is 13 km from the property. Buses and taxis are available to reach Nozawa Onsen. Matsumoto Airport, the nearest, is 119 km away.

Is there Wi-Fi available?

Yes, free Wi-Fi is available throughout the property for the comfort of guests.
